What is Attestation for Family Visa in UAE?

Attestation is the process of verifying the authenticity of personal documents issued outside the UAE, such as marriage certificates, birth certificates, or educational degrees.

It is mandatory for expatriates who are sponsoring their family members under a UAE residence visa.

Required Documents for UAE Family Visa Attestation

1. Marriage Certificate

To sponsor your wife/husband

  • Must be attested by:

    • Home country (Notary/Home Dept/Foreign Affairs)

    • UAE Embassy in your country

    • MOFA (Ministry of Foreign Affairs) in the UAE

2. Birth Certificate

To sponsor your child

  • Same attestation process as above

  • Translation to Arabic is required if not originally in Arabic or English

3. Educational Certificates

In some emirates, required for salary-based sponsorship or wife’s visa under husband’s sponsorship

  • Degree attestation may be asked depending on sponsor’s profession

4. Passport Copies & Emirates ID

  • Sponsor’s passport and Emirates ID

  • Dependent’s passport copy

5. Tenancy Contract (Ejari) & Salary Certificate

  • For visa application (not attested, but required for application)

Step-by-Step Family Visa Attestation Process

  1. Notarization in Home Country

    • Have the document notarized by your local authority (e.g., Home Department, Notary Public)

  2. Ministry of Foreign Affairs (Home Country)

    • This validates the notarization

  3. UAE Embassy Attestation in Home Country

    • Submit to UAE Embassy for legalization

  4. MOFA Attestation in the UAE

    • Once the document is in UAE, the final step is attestation by MOFA UAE

  5. Certified Arabic Translation (if required)

    • Translate documents to Arabic via a licensed translator

Family Visa Attestation Fees (2025 Estimate)

Document Type

Approx. Fee

Marriage Certificate

AED 150 – 550

Birth Certificate

AED 150 – 550

Translation Service

AED 60 – 120

Service Charges

AED 100 – 200

Note: Fees vary by country of origin, urgency, and translation needs.

⏱️ Processing Time

  • Standard: 3–5 working days

  • Express: 1–2 days via professional services

⚠️ Important Tips

  • UAE authorities will reject documents without complete attestation

  • Always ensure correct spelling of names across all documents

  • Attested copies must be clear and readable


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I apply for family visa without attestation?

A: No. Attested marriage and birth certificates are mandatory for the application to be accepted.

Q: Is MOFA attestation enough?

A: No, you must complete home country attestation and UAE Embassy stamping before MOFA.
